What to Expect
As part of this private Statue of Liberty and Ellis Island Tour, visitors can expect to first visit Liberty Island, where they’ll have the chance to admire the iconic Manhattan skyline and explore the artifacts and exhibits within the Statue of Liberty Museum.
Afterwards, the group will head to the nearby Ellis Island Immigration Station and Museum, delving into the rich history and stories of the millions who passed through its doors in search of a new life in America.
Throughout the tour, the knowledgeable guide will provide detailed information and insights, bringing the past to life and offering a comprehensive understanding of these two national landmarks and their significance in American history.

Travel Tips
Visitors should dress appropriately for the weather conditions, as downtown Manhattan can be quite windy.
Security screenings are required before entering the ferry and pedestal, and certain items are prohibited. Lockers are available on Liberty Island for storing large belongings.
The tour is wheelchair accessible, and most travelers can participate. It’s a private tour/activity exclusive to your group, so you’ll enjoy a personalized experience.
When planning your trip, keep in mind that the tour operates regardless of weather conditions. However, you may want to reschedule for better weather if possible to enhance your enjoyment of the sights.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I Bring My Own Food and Drinks on the Tour?
Yes, guests can bring their own food and drinks on the tour. However, certain prohibited items may not be allowed through security screenings. It’s best to check the tour’s policies before packing.
Is There a Dress Code for the Tour?
There is no formal dress code, but it’s recommended to dress appropriately for the weather conditions. Casual, comfortable clothing and closed-toe shoes are advised. Bring layers in case of wind or rain on the tour.
Can I Take Photos Inside the Statue of Liberty?
Yes, visitors are generally allowed to take photos inside the Statue of Liberty, including the pedestal and observation deck. However, tripods and professional camera equipment are prohibited. Photography must be done in a way that doesn’t disrupt other visitors.
How Long Does the Entire Tour Take?
The entire tour typically takes 3-4 hours to complete. Visitors can expect to spend 1-2 hours exploring the Statue of Liberty and 1-2 hours at Ellis Island, with additional time for transportation and security screenings.
Is the Tour Suitable for Children?
The tour is generally suitable for children, as it includes wheelchair accessibility and most travelers can participate. However, parents should consider factors like security screenings, prohibited items, and the potential for wind and rain when deciding if it’s appropriate for their child.
